friendica-github/view/theme/quattro/icons.less

95 lines
3 KiB
Text
Raw Normal View History

/*
* SPDX-FileCopyrightText: 2010-2024 the Friendica project
*
* SPDX-License-Identifier: AGPL-3.0-or-later
*/
2011-09-16 10:50:15 +00:00
// Quattro Theme LESS file
2011-09-05 09:14:43 +00:00
/* icons */
.icons(@size: 22) {
&.notify { background-image: url("../../../images/icons/@{size}/notify_off.png"); }
&.intro { background-image: url("icons/contacts_off.png"); }
&.mail { background-image: url("icons/messages_off.png"); }
2011-09-05 09:14:43 +00:00
&.gear { background-image: url("../../../images/icons/@{size}/gear.png"); }
&.like { background-image: url("icons/like.png"); }
&.dislike { background-image: url("icons/dislike.png"); }
2011-09-05 09:14:43 +00:00
&.add { background-image: url("../../../images/icons/@{size}/add.png"); }
&.delete { background-image: url("../../../images/icons/@{size}/delete.png"); }
&.edit { background-image: url("../../../images/icons/@{size}/edit.png"); }
&.pencil { background-image: url("../../../images/icons/@{size}/edit.png"); }
2011-09-16 10:50:15 +00:00
&.star { background-image: url("../../../images/icons/@{size}/star.png"); }
&.menu { background-image: url("../../../images/icons/@{size}/menu.png"); }
&.link { background-image: url("../../../images/icons/@{size}/link.png"); }
&.remote-link { background-image: url("../../../images/icons/@{size}/link.png"); }
2011-09-16 10:50:15 +00:00
&.lock { background-image: url("../../../images/icons/@{size}/lock.png"); }
&.unlock { background-image: url("../../../images/icons/@{size}/unlock.png"); }
&.plugin { background-image: url("../../../images/icons/@{size}/plugin.png"); }
2012-02-15 10:10:02 +00:00
&.type-unkn { background-image: url("../../../images/icons/@{size}/zip.png"); }
2014-09-17 08:59:19 +00:00
&.type-application { background-image: url("../../../images/icons/@{size}/zip.png"); }
2012-02-15 10:10:02 +00:00
&.type-audio{ background-image: url("../../../images/icons/@{size}/audio.png"); }
&.type-video{ background-image: url("../../../images/icons/@{size}/video.png"); }
&.type-image{ background-image: url("../../../images/icons/@{size}/image.png"); }
&.type-text { background-image: url("../../../images/icons/@{size}/text.png"); }
2012-04-13 09:56:56 +00:00
&.language { background-image: url("icons/language.png"); }
2011-09-16 10:50:15 +00:00
2011-09-05 09:14:43 +00:00
}
.icon {
background-color: transparent ;
background-repeat: no-repeat;
background-position: left center;
2011-09-05 09:14:43 +00:00
display: block;
overflow: hidden;
text-indent: -9999px;
padding: 1px;
&.text {
text-indent: 0px;
}
min-width:22px; height: 22px;
.icons(22);
&.text { padding: 10px 0px 0px 25px; }
2011-09-16 10:50:15 +00:00
&.s10 {
min-width:10px; height: 10px;
2011-09-16 10:50:15 +00:00
.icons(10);
&.text { padding: 2px 0px 0px 15px; }
2011-09-16 10:50:15 +00:00
}
2011-09-05 09:14:43 +00:00
&.s16 {
min-width:16px; height: 16px;
2011-09-05 09:14:43 +00:00
.icons(16);
&.text { padding: 4px 0px 0px 20px; }
2011-09-05 09:14:43 +00:00
}
&.s22 {
min-width:22px; height: 22px;
2011-09-05 09:14:43 +00:00
.icons(22);
&.text { padding: 10px 0px 0px 25px; }
2011-09-05 09:14:43 +00:00
}
2011-09-16 10:50:15 +00:00
&.s48 {
width:48px; height: 48px;
.icons(48);
2011-09-16 10:50:15 +00:00
}
2011-09-05 09:14:43 +00:00
&.on {
background-image: url("icons/addon_on.png");
min-width:16px;
height: 16px;
background-position: 0px 0px;
}
&.off {
background-image: url("icons/addon_off.png");
width: 16px;
height: 16px;
background-position: 0px 0px;
}
2011-09-05 09:14:43 +00:00
}